About Vinayaka mission university

Vinayaka Missions University, also known as the Vinayaka Mission’s Research Foundation (VMRF), is a NAAC accredited deemed to be university under section 3 of the UGC Act of 1956 located in Salem, Tamil Nadu. The university was established in 1981 amil Nadu. The university was established in 1981 by philanthropist Dr. A. Shanmugasundaram as “Thirumuruga Kirupananda Variyar Thavathiru Sundara Swamigal (TKVTSS) Medical Educational and Charitable Trust”. A vibrant university with a multi-cultural experience, it got its “deemed to be” status in 2001. With the motto of “Vision, Wisdom, Unity”, the university aims to spread education globally in the fields of Medicine, Dentistry, Paramedical, Homeopathy, Engineering, Management, and Basic Science. The university boasts more than 15,000 students in courses of M.B.B.S., M.D., M.S., PG Diploma, B.D.S., M.D.S., B.E./B.Tech, M.E./M.Tech, M.B.A., M.Com, B.Pharm, M.Pharm, B.P.T., M.P.T., and many more.
